d4vd: Complete Biography and Career Timeline
David Anthony Burke, known professionally as d4vd (stylized in all lowercase), is an American singer and songwriter whose meteoric rise is one of the most compelling stories in modern music. He was born on March 28, 2005, making him one of the most successful artists to emerge from the Gen Z generation.
- Full Name: David Anthony Burke
- Date of Birth: March 28, 2005
- Hometown: Houston, Texas
- Career Start: Initially passionate about professional gaming, d4vd began making music to soundtrack his own video game montages, primarily recording in his sister's closet using a basic setup.
- Breakthrough Songs: "Romantic Homicide" (2022) and "Here With Me" (2022), both of which went massively viral on TikTok.
- Musical Style: His sound is a unique blend of genres, including Indie, R&B, Hip-Hop, and Rock, which he aims to make a "genre in itself." His influences include anime, manga (like *Attack on Titan* and *Demon Slayer*), and indie artists like The Neighbourhood.
- Debut Project: The EP *Petals To Thorns* (2023), which features "Here With Me."
